I'm looking at a '95 Honda Accord LX, 70,000 miles, interior & exterior
excellent except for a small patch of rust - size of a quarter on hood,
new tires, tune ups and oil changes done faithfully, single owner, garaged
winters while owner was in FLA.

Standard Transmission.

NOTHING has been done to the car except a connector pipe between the
muffler and somethng (can't remeber what the part was)

Gas gauge does not work properly.

What maintenance is usually required around 70K miles? Brakes? Timing
chain or belt? What should I watch out for? What typically goes wrong or
needs replacement around 70K?

Is is typical the the clutch doesn't catch unitl it is almost all the way
up or is that an indication of a potental clutch problem?

Does Honda put out a list of suggested maintenance for car owners?

I have heard from some people outside the forum that I should be concerned
that nothing has been done to the car for 70,000 miles other than tuneups
and oil changes.

>What maintenance is usually required around 70K miles? Brakes? Timing
>chain or belt?


The timing belt is overdue for a change. It's OK for milage but was
due for change at 6 years.

> What should I watch out for? What typically goes wrong or
>needs replacement around 70K?


Check the condition of the driveshaft universals and boots, and
another foible is the distributor bearing.

>Is is typical the the clutch doesn't catch unitl it is almost all the way
>up or is that an indication of a potental clutch problem?


Probably just needs adjusting.
